YEREVAN. – Vazgen Khachikyan’s attorney Zhora Varosyan is preparing the petition wherewith they will appeal the recent judgment by the court of first instance.
On December 8, Khachikyan, the former Chief of the State Social Security Service of Armenia, who was charged with fraud and embezzlement of large public funds, was found guilty by the court and sentenced to twelve years in prison.
“We will appeal not solely the sentence, but the legal qualification of the act.
“Once the petition is prepared, I will consult with my client in detail, and we will submit the appeal to the Criminal Court of Appeal,” the attorney told Armenian News-NEWS.am.
According to the indictment, Vazgen Khachikyan, together with several other Service officials and persons in charge, had appropriated, from 2006 to 2010, suspended pensions totaling 267,266,000 drams (approx. $593,745).
